The pyramid complex suffered from different types of structural damage and construction materials decay and disintegration. The sources of this degradation can generally be classified as: nature, time, and man-made.

An estimate of the rate of talus formation indicates that the pyramid annually loses only 0.01 percent of its total volume and could remain standing for 100,000 years.

In the 12th century, Kurdish ruler al-Malek al-Aziz Othman ben Yusuf attempted to destroy one of the pyramids, but only successfully damaged the smallest, leaving a vertical gash on the north face.

Although tourists were once able to freely climb the pyramids, that is now illegal. Offenders face up to three years in prison as penalty. In 2016 a teenage tourist was banned from visiting Egypt for life after posting photos and videos on social media of his illicit climb.
The Great Pyramid of Giza was robbed of its treasures thousands of years ago. The passage that all tourists enter today is the Robber's Tunnel that was presumably used for plundering everything of value inside.

But what the Egyptians lacked in tools, they made up for with science and engineering precision. Smith explains that they developed and used the cubit rod to measure and lay out the dimensions of the pyramid; a square level to level horizontal surfaces, and a 3:4:5 framing square to create precision 90-degree angles.
